Elapsed Time

Elapsed time is the amount of time that passes between a start time and end time.

Strategy: count up in steps.

Example: From 2:15 to 3:45 → 2:15 to 3:15 = 1 hour, then 3:15 to 3:45 = 30 min. Total = 1 hr 30 min.

Worked Example
Start: 9:30, End: 10:45. Elapsed time?
Solution9:30 to 10:30 = 1 hour. 10:30 to 10:45 = 15 minutes. Total = 1 hr 15 min.
2
Worked Example
Start: 3:20, End: 5:05. Elapsed time?
Solution3:20 to 4:20 = 1 hour. 4:20 to 5:05 = 45 minutes. Total = 1 hr 45 min.
3
Worked Example
Start: 11:50, End: 1:25 p.m. Elapsed time?
Solution11:50 to 12:50 = 1 hour. 12:50 to 1:25 = 35 minutes. Total = 1 hr 35 min.

Key Points

  • Count up in hours first, then minutes.
  • Cross noon carefully: 11:30 to 1:00 = 1 hr 30 min.
  • Draw a time line to visualize elapsed time.
